refactor: federated cluster controller #727
Annotations
27 errors and 1 warning
typos
Process completed with exit code 2.
|
test (1.19):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.19):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.19):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.19):
pkg/util/annotation/submap_test.go#L25
no required module provides package github.com/kubewharf/kubeadmiral/pkg/controllers/util/annotation; to add it:
|
test (1.19):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.19):
pkg/controllers/automigration/util_test.go#L40
undefined: countUnschedulablePods
|
test (1.19):
pkg/controllers/follower/util_test.go#L306
undefined: FollowerReference
|
test (1.19):
pkg/controllers/follower/util_test.go#L309
undefined: FollowerReference
|
test (1.19):
pkg/controllers/follower/util_test.go#L317
undefined: getFollowersFromPod
|
test (1.19):
pkg/controllers/statusaggregator/plugins/job_test.go#L187
undefined: NewJobPlugin
|
test (1.20):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.20):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.20):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.20):
pkg/util/annotation/submap_test.go#L25
no required module provides package github.com/kubewharf/kubeadmiral/pkg/controllers/util/annotation; to add it:
|
test (1.20):
pkg/controllers/override/util_test.go#L30
no required module provides package github.com/kubewharf/kubeadmiral/pkg/apis/types/v1alpha1; to add it:
|
test (1.20):
pkg/controllers/automigration/util_test.go#L40
undefined: countUnschedulablePods
|
test (1.20):
pkg/controllers/follower/util_test.go#L306
undefined: FollowerReference
|
test (1.20):
pkg/controllers/follower/util_test.go#L309
undefined: FollowerReference
|
test (1.20):
pkg/controllers/follower/util_test.go#L317
undefined: getFollowersFromPod
|
test (1.20):
pkg/controllers/statusaggregator/plugins/job_test.go#L187
undefined: NewJobPlugin
|
lint:
cmd/controller-manager/app/core.go#L32
File is not `gci`-ed with --skip-generated -s standard -s default -s prefix(github.com/kubewharf/kubeadmiral) --custom-order (gci)
|
lint:
pkg/controllers/status/controller.go#L308
cyclomatic complexity 36 of func `(*StatusController).reconcile` is high (> 30) (gocyclo)
|
lint:
cmd/controller-manager/app/core.go#L32
File is not `gofumpt`-ed (gofumpt)
|
lint:
cmd/controller-manager/app/core.go#L157
func `startFederatedClusterController` is unused (unused)
|
lint:
pkg/util/informermanager/federatedinformermanager.go#L39
import "k8s.io/client-go/listers/core/v1" imported as "v1" but must be "corev1listers" according to config (importas)
|
lint
issues found
|
typos:
docs/quickstart.md#L6
"propgating" should be "propagating".
|